Output 83664d81f196af508358eb6f35cd20159325472821146f1c45d32b2423130b45:705

value
2079
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b6e41517b17fb544d5d3d83ad7090b09ca443ca35837b8373705095851f7d41b
address
bc1pkmjp29a30765f4wnmqadwzgtp89yg09rtqmmsdehq5y4s50h6sds3p4qjt
transaction
83664d81f196af508358eb6f35cd20159325472821146f1c45d32b2423130b45
confirmations
108574
spent
true